CamelBak H.A.W.G. LR 20 Hydration Backpack User Manual

1. Introduction

Thank you for choosing the CamelBak H.A.W.G. LR 20 Hydration Backpack. This manual provides essential information for the proper setup, operation, maintenance, and care of your new hydration system. Designed for extended adventures, the H.A.W.G. LR 20 offers maximum storage, superior hydration, and a lower center of gravity for enhanced stability.

Key features include the CRUX 3-liter lumbar reservoir with integrated compression, LR/Low Rider technology that shifts weight from your shoulders to your hips, and a Flow AC back panel combined with padded, perforated straps for optimal comfort and ventilation. It also features a magnetic tube trap for easy hydration access and an integrated rain cover for weather protection.

2. Setup

2.1 Filling the Reservoir

  1. Open the reservoir cap by twisting it counter-clockwise.
  2. Fill the CRUX reservoir with water or your preferred hydration liquid. Do not fill with carbonated beverages, milk, or alcohol.
  3. Ensure the reservoir is not overfilled.
  4. Close the cap by twisting it clockwise until securely tightened to prevent leaks.

2.2 Inserting the Reservoir into the Backpack

  1. Locate the dedicated hydration compartment at the lower back of the backpack.
  2. Slide the filled reservoir into this compartment, ensuring the hose exits through the designated port.
  3. Secure the reservoir using any internal clips or straps provided to prevent shifting during activity.

2.3 Adjusting the Backpack

  1. Put on the backpack.
  2. Adjust the shoulder straps for a snug but comfortable fit.
  3. Fasten and adjust the sternum strap across your chest. The magnetic tube trap is integrated into this strap for easy hose management.
  4. Fasten and adjust the waist belt around your hips. This is crucial for the LR (Low Rider) technology to effectively transfer weight.
  5. Ensure the backpack sits comfortably and securely on your back, with the weight distributed evenly.

2.4 Attaching a Helmet

The H.A.W.G. LR 20 features universal helmet hooks. Locate these hooks on the exterior of the backpack and use them to securely attach your helmet when not in use.

3. Operating

3.1 Drinking from the Hydration Tube

  1. Locate the bite valve at the end of the hydration tube.
  2. Gently bite down on the silicone valve and suck to draw water.
  3. After drinking, release the bite valve. The self-sealing design will prevent drips.
  4. Use the magnetic tube trap on the sternum strap to keep the tube secure and easily accessible.

3.2 Using Storage Compartments

The H.A.W.G. LR 20 offers multiple pockets and compartments for organizing your gear. Utilize the main compartment for larger items, and smaller zippered pockets for essentials like tools, snacks, and personal items. The waist belt also includes additional storage for quick-access items.

3.3 Deploying the Rain Cover

In adverse weather conditions, locate the integrated rain cover, typically stored in a dedicated pocket at the bottom of the backpack. Unfold and stretch the cover over the entire backpack to protect your gear from rain and moisture.

4. Maintenance

4.1 Cleaning the Reservoir

  1. After each use, empty the reservoir completely.
  2. Fill the reservoir with warm water and a mild soap solution.
  3. Use a reservoir brush (sold separately) to scrub the interior.
  4. Rinse thoroughly with clean water until all soap residue is gone.
  5. For deep cleaning or to remove stubborn odors, use CamelBak cleaning tablets (sold separately).

4.2 Cleaning the Hydration Tube and Bite Valve

  1. Disconnect the tube from the reservoir.
  2. Remove the bite valve from the tube.
  3. Clean the tube with a tube brush and warm soapy water.
  4. Clean the bite valve with warm soapy water, ensuring all parts are free of residue.
  5. Rinse all components thoroughly.

4.3 Cleaning the Backpack

The backpack itself should be spot cleaned with warm water and mild soap. Do not machine wash, tumble dry, or iron the backpack, as this can damage the materials and coatings. Air dry completely before storage.

4.4 Drying and Storage

Ensure all components (reservoir, tube, bite valve, and backpack) are completely dry before storing to prevent mold and mildew growth. Hang the reservoir upside down with the opening propped open to allow air circulation. Store the backpack in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ight.

5. Troubleshooting

5.1 Low Water Flow

  • Check the bite valve: Ensure it is not clogged or twisted. Gently bite down to open the valve.
  • Check the tube: Ensure the tube is not kinked or pinched.
  • Check the reservoir: Make sure there is sufficient water and the reservoir is not collapsed or compressed in a way that restricts flow.
  • Clean components: A dirty bite valve or tube can restrict flow. Refer to the maintenance section for cleaning instructions.

5.2 Leaks

  • Check the reservoir cap: Ensure it is securely tightened.
  • Check tube connections: Verify that the tube is firmly connected to the reservoir and the bite valve.
  • Inspect for damage: Examine the reservoir and tube for any punctures, tears, or cracks. If damaged, replacement parts may be necessary.
